Boa tarde.
Apelo aos amigos por não conseguir solução alguma depois de 4 dias seguidos lutando contra o Base...
Estou tentando criar uma estrutura para controle de tráfego no meu trabalho e, mesmo usando o guia
produzido por vocês, nem o diabo acha solução kkkkkkkkkkkkk
Tenho 2 tabelas principais, Carros (campos IDcarros, integer, carro-modelo, text, e motorista,
text) e Agenda (IDagenda, Integer, IDcarros, integer, data, usuário, setor, escola - todos Text,
entrada obrigatória -, horário de saída, horário de retorno - os 2 Time - e observações - campo
tipo Memo). Estabeleci a relação entre eles e funciona OK, sem problemas.
O problema acontece quando eu tento associar 3 outras tabelas à Agenda: Usuário (usuário, chave
primária, e IDusuário), Setor (setores, chave primária, e IDsetores) e Escola (escolas, chave
primária, e IDsetores). A função destes é evitar que sejam lançados valores inválidos nos
respectivos campos da tabela Agenda.
Ao gerar o formulário, faço a partir da tabela Carros e coloco os campos da tabela Agenda no
subformulário (são 27 carros para uma infinidade de eventos diários). Quando substituo alguns
campos do subformulário por caixa de listagem naqueles respectivos campos (usuário, setor e
escola), ao inserir as informações ele não aceita gravar, dá a mensagem
Integrity constraint violation - no parent SYS_FK_113 table:usuário instatement [INSERT INTO
"agenda"( "IDcarros", "data", "escola", "horário retorno", "horário saída", "setor", "usuário")
VALUES (?,?,?,?,?,?,?)]
Lembrando que dá um outro erro quando tento associar a caixa de listagem com um SQL, ele só
"aceita" no modo tabela, e dá este erro...
Se puderem salvar meu pescoço agradeço...
Valeu!
Rodrigo G. Stella
--
Você está recebendo e-mails da lista docs@pt-br.libreoffice.org
# Informações sobre os comandos disponíveis (em inglês):
mande e-mail vazio para docs+unsubscribe@pt-br.libreoffice.org
# Cancelar sua assinatura: mande e-mail vazio para:
docs+unsubscribe@pt-br.libreoffice.org
# Arquivo de mensagens: http://listarchives.libreoffice.org/pt-br/docs/
Context
- [pt-br-docs] LibreOffice Base · Rodrigo Stella
Privacy Policy |
Impressum (Legal Info) |
Copyright information: Unless otherwise specified, all text and images
on this website are licensed under the
Creative Commons Attribution-Share Alike 3.0 License.
This does not include the source code of LibreOffice, which is
licensed under the Mozilla Public License (
MPLv2).
"LibreOffice" and "The Document Foundation" are
registered trademarks of their corresponding registered owners or are
in actual use as trademarks in one or more countries. Their respective
logos and icons are also subject to international copyright laws. Use
thereof is explained in our
trademark policy.